import { beforeEach, describe, expect, it } from "vitest";
import { eq } from "drizzle-orm";
import { db } from "@/db";
import { sessions, users } from "@/db/schema";
import { hashPassword, verifyPassword } from "@/lib/auth/password";
import {
createSession,
deleteSession,
validateSessionToken,
} from "@/lib/auth/session";
import { resetDb } from "../helpers/db";
beforeEach(resetDb);
async function insertUser() {
const [user] = await db
.insert(users)
.values({ username: "admin", passwordHash: await hashPassword("correct horse") })
.returning();
return user;
}
describe("password hashing", () => {
it("verifies the original password and rejects others", async () => {
const hash = await hashPassword("s3cret-passphrase");
expect(hash.startsWith("scrypt$")).toBe(true);
expect(hash).not.toContain("s3cret-passphrase");
expect(await verifyPassword(hash, "s3cret-passphrase")).toBe(true);
expect(await verifyPassword(hash, "wrong")).toBe(false);
});
it("produces unique salts per hash", async () => {
expect(await hashPassword("same")).not.toBe(await hashPassword("same"));
});
it("rejects malformed stored hashes without throwing", async () => {
expect(await verifyPassword("garbage", "x")).toBe(false);
expect(await verifyPassword("scrypt$bad$data", "x")).toBe(false);
});
});
describe("sessions", () => {
it("round-trips a valid session token", async () => {
const user = await insertUser();
const { token, expiresAt } = await createSession(user.id);
expect(expiresAt.getTime()).toBeGreaterThan(Date.now());
const sessionUser = await validateSessionToken(token);
expect(sessionUser).toEqual({ id: user.id, username: "admin" });
// Only a hash of the token is stored.
const rows = await db.select().from(sessions);
expect(rows).toHaveLength(1);
expect(rows[0].id).not.toBe(token);
});
it("rejects unknown tokens", async () => {
await insertUser();
expect(await validateSessionToken("not-a-real-token")).toBeNull();
expect(await validateSessionToken("")).toBeNull();
});
it("treats expired sessions as absent and deletes them", async () => {
const user = await insertUser();
const { token } = await createSession(user.id);
await db
.update(sessions)
.set({ expiresAt: new Date(Date.now() - 1000) })
.where(eq(sessions.userId, user.id));
expect(await validateSessionToken(token)).toBeNull();
expect(await db.select().from(sessions)).toHaveLength(0);
});
it("invalidates a session on logout", async () => {
const user = await insertUser();
const { token } = await createSession(user.id);
await deleteSession(token);
expect(await validateSessionToken(token)).toBeNull();
});
});
